Hello there,

I've booked a WDW resort-dining package and my window to reserve restaurants just opened. I tried to book Le Cellier for dinner on December 4th 2010 (Saturday).

Everything was booked solid (!!) There were no availability at all for dinner (and for lunch too, I checked for the heck of it).

I was wondering if this was a normal occurrence, but all of the other sit down restaurants I checked (France, England, Japan, China) all had availability for that dinner time slot I was looking for.

Does anybody have an idea why this happend? Computer glitch? Renovations? or just insanely popular?

Thank you in advance for any insights!!

Best,
 
Small restaurant, insanely popular, tables being held for the Candlelight Processional packages.

It happened because you tried to book at 180 +10 instead of the new 190 day procedure for getting ADRs. In other words, your ADR window opened 10 days sooner than you thought.

I've been hearing rumours that Disney may be considering redefining Le Cellier as a 'signature' restaurant, and hence it may change two credits on the dining plan - not to mention I'm sure the prices would go up too.

I guess they do need to do something about the insane levels of demand anyway - and from a purely commercial point of view, if the place is regularly selling out 180 days in advance then they could certainly be making more money out of it.
